Pau Gasol opens up on his NBA Europe role and long-term vision

Spanish basketball legend Pau Gasol confirmed his involvement in the NBA Europe project, though he said he does not have a specific role yet.

At the moment, Gasol emphasized that his role is not yet defined; he is currently engaged in discussions with the NBA, FIBA, and various clubs to gain a clearer perspective on how basketball growth in Europe should take shape.

"At this moment, there isn't a defined role. I'm simply working with the NBA, with FIBA, and talking with teams to see what the evolution of basketball growth in Europe should be," he said in an interview with Toni Canyameras for Mundo Deportivo.

"From there, we'll see what role I end up playing, whether it's at the league level or with a team. I think there's a significant opportunity to take a step forward and help our sport of basketball grow in Europe."

The former FC Barcelona player also highlighted his close connection with his hometown club and his hope to collaborate with them on the new project.

"My link with Barca is natural and self-evident. Beyond any specific role, the priority is for the club to understand the core concept and for us to collaborate with the NBA on a strategic approach."

"Ultimately, this represents a major paradigm shift for European basketball and the club's operational model. We must progress toward this goal gradually, but we are confident the outcome will be positive for everyone involved," he explained.

Gasol also shared his vision for NBA Europe and its main goal of establishing a sustainable model.

"Our ultimate goal is to transform European basketball into a sustainable model, one with real room for growth rather than a loss-making sport," he said.

"We have a unique opportunity to build new relationships and a different model that offers a much greater margin for impact than what we have seen until now. We need to shift our approach, define our strategy, and establish a stable foundation from the start."

"We should build this from the ground up," he added. "Basketball is a globally significant sport, and I believe we have the space to enhance it as both an experience and a spectacle, going beyond just the magic of the game itself. That is exactly what we have come here to achieve."
